Transaction 8b5458403e3ccd896f629fc3492a5f84e71dba238b7b1dd9a86a93096141916d
1 Input
1 Output
-
8b5458403e3ccd896f629fc3492a5f84e71dba238b7b1dd9a86a93096141916d:0
- value
- 58430
- script pubkey
- OP_0 OP_PUSHBYTES_32 e7693e1815f31b4446e03e8e9ae079ce8c78fefb0c9b553dfc0186b8389f47d3
- address
- bc1qua5nuxq47vd5g3hq868f4cree6x83lhmpjd4200uqxrtswylglfsgp8euq